Zynq is based on an ARM Cortex-A9 MPCore, which features the
arm_global_timer in its SCU. Therefore enable the timer for Zynq.

Signed-off-by: Soren Brinkmann <[email protected]>
---
 arch/arm/boot/dts/zynq-7000.dtsi | 8 ++++++++
 arch/arm/mach-zynq/Kconfig       | 1 +
 2 files changed, 9 insertions(+)

diff --git a/arch/arm/boot/dts/zynq-7000.dtsi b/arch/arm/boot/dts/zynq-7000.dtsi
index e32b92b..eaacb39 100644
--- a/arch/arm/boot/dts/zynq-7000.dtsi
+++ b/arch/arm/boot/dts/zynq-7000.dtsi
@@ -92,6 +92,14 @@
                        };
                };
 
+               global_timer: global_timer@f8f00200 {
+                       compatible = "arm,cortex-a9-global-timer";
+                       reg = <0xf8f00200 0x20>;
+                       interrupts = <1 11 0x301>;
+                       interrupt-parent = <&intc>;
+                       clocks = <&clkc 4>;
+               };
+
                ttc0: ttc0@f8001000 {
                        interrupt-parent = <&intc>;
                        interrupts = < 0 10 4 0 11 4 0 12 4 >;
diff --git a/arch/arm/mach-zynq/Kconfig b/arch/arm/mach-zynq/Kconfig
index 04f8a4a..6b04260 100644
--- a/arch/arm/mach-zynq/Kconfig
+++ b/arch/arm/mach-zynq/Kconfig
@@ -13,5 +13,6 @@ config ARCH_ZYNQ
        select HAVE_SMP
        select SPARSE_IRQ
        select CADENCE_TTC_TIMER
+       select ARM_GLOBAL_TIMER
        help
          Support for Xilinx Zynq ARM Cortex A9 Platform
